Transaction 505013b8eb79949c1d15fcdc2159227a5ccb43b4eb2aa1109367b999f35e75f0
1 Input
1 Output
-
505013b8eb79949c1d15fcdc2159227a5ccb43b4eb2aa1109367b999f35e75f0:0
- value
- 38081289
- script pubkey
- OP_0 OP_PUSHBYTES_20 e61abf3a8ff2b74f721955d63b6d085ca6ba25d4
- address
- bc1qucdt7w5072m57use2htrkmggtjnt5fw5wx0ylm